I'm getting to the point of completely giving up kernel development outside the ARM tree, which basically means leaving serial, pci, and pcmcia to other people.
I have been trying for the last 5 days to get Linus to accept two patches small patches:
1. a patch to register tty_devclass using postcore_initcall().
This is necessary before I can push the next set of serial changes. Without it, the serial layer will oops in sysfs when it tries to register drivers.
2. a patch to restore the PCI device probing, so we don't probe all functions when we discover that function 0 is not present. This is the behaviour we had prior to 2.5.64.
Both of these patches have been sent to Linus several times over the past 5 days, and each time they have been completely ignored without explaination.
I have a huge pile of patches backing up here. I'm at the point where I'm going to give up updating them to bk-curr, and testing them before sending each to Linus due to the number of patches. Going around this loop just takes too much of my time to make it worth while.
My backlog currently consists of:
8 PCI patches (1 needs to be further cut up) 10 PCMCIA patches (1 needs to be further cut up) 1 tty_io.c patch 16 serial csets
there are some dependencies between these patches, and getting the stuff applied in the right order is absolutely paramount to ensure that things don't break.
So, any suggestions on how to handle this better, and above all get Linus to start applying stuff?
